How K-CUT works

Calcium polystyrene sulfonate is an ion exchange resin. It travels through the gut releasing calcium and taking up potassium in exchange, and the bound potassium leaves in the stool. High blood potassium is one of the genuinely dangerous complications of kidney failure -- it disturbs heart rhythm without warning symptoms -- and a binder removes potassium from the body rather than merely shifting it into cells the way insulin and glucose do.
